The Tight End Recruiting Debacle

 
C.J. Fiedorowicz // Via NW Hearld Drew Thurman (10:28 pm) I would be lying if I said the 2010 recruiting class has not frustrated me daily. I have tried to put every imaginable spin on why this class has started slow or why things might heat up later on, but my attempts are coming up short. What adds insult to injury is the way the tight end recruiting in this class has transpired, which seems to have taken up many of the headlines. It seems like the staff offers a new tight end everyday, and with each offer there seems to be more desperation. Tressel and company want a top-tier tight end, but as most of us already know, why would one come to block for the Buckeyes? The process started off badly when Alex Smith (West Chester, Ohio) committed to play for Brian Kelly and the Bearcats before Tressel even could throw an offer his way.
